Title | Unpublished manuscript, 'Observations on the plan proposed by Mr Parrot of St Petersbourg [Petersburg] for mending the hole over the tunnel, securing the works against future irruption [upsurges] and in case of any irruption [upsurge], for saving the men' by Mc I [Marc Isambard] Brunel |
Date | 16 June 1828 |
Description | Brunel summarises the work of Georg Friedrich Parrot relative to a method for repairing a hole present in the earth above a tunnel, caused by an upsurge of a river. He also explains how further upsurges would be prevented and how workers would be saved should another accident occur.
